
Novo Earns Upstate's Women's Tennis Program's First Division I ITA Ranking
9/15/2008 12:00:00 AM | Women's Tennis
Sept. 15, 2008
SPARTANBURG, S.C. - After earning Atlantic Sun Conference Player of the Year honors and winning a school-record 29 matches in 2007-08, senior Anna Novo (Caracas, Venezuela/El-Angel) was rewarded for her efforts once again by becoming the first woman Spartan in the Division I era to earn an ITA ranking. She is currently ranked 124th in the ITA singles preseason rankings.
Novo, who won a school-record 29 singles matches in 2007-08, enters her senior looking to chase down a host of Upstate career records, currently sitting seven singles wins, 12 doubles wins, and 19 combined wins away from the school records set by Diana Martinez (2004-08). A two-time Division II All-American in singles play, Novo is 66-19 all-time in singles play, 52-32 in doubles play and 118-51 overall.
Only one other A-Sun player is ranked, as ETSU's Yevgeniya Stupak is currently ranked 63rd in the nation. Novo and Stupak are developing a heated rivalry, with Novo winning the first meeting between the two during a dual meet in the spring season and Stupak besting Novo in the finals of the Upstate Fall Tournament.
Current student assistant coach Sandy Franz was the first Spartan to earn an ITA Division I ranking, beginning the 2008 spring season ranked 96th on the men's side.
